有效微生物制剂(EM)对建鲤生长和水质变化的影响

摘    要:将EM作为建鲤饲料添加剂和水质净化剂,经45d的饲养,纠果表明:1)EM有促生长作用,随着添加量(2%,4%,6%)的增加,实验组建鲤的H增重率分别比对照组提高0.60%,,9.2%和16.0%;饵料系数脚低1.3%,7.4%和22.9%。2)EM对水质有良好的净化作用,实验组氨氮含量比对照组分别下降1.72%,6.69%和3.03%的:COD值降低14.90%.19.27%和17.28%:pH值则比对照组高.

Effect of Effective Microorganisms (EM) on the Growth of Jian Carp and the Quality of Water

Abstract:After raising 45 d in using EM as fodder additive to Jian carp and as the parifying agnt ofwater quality, the result shows EM can obiously promote Jian carp grow and improve the quality ofwater. 1) The weight gain rate per day of the 2%,4%,6% groups is increaded by 0.6%,9.2% and 16.0%respectivily comparing with the control. The feed coefficiency of the experimental groups is decreasedby 1.3%,7.4% and 22.90%. 2) The data of NH3-NH4+ of the experimental groups is decreased by 1.72%,6.60% and 3.03% respectivily. The data of COD of the experimental groups is decreased by 14.79%,19.27% and 17.82%, respectivily, too, comparingg with the control. The PH is highter than that of thecontrol group.
